Four Indian Chess Grandmasters Set to Compete at Paris Esports World Cup

Indian chess is stepping onto one of sport's newest global stages as four Grandmasters prepare to represent the nation at the Esports World Cup in Paris, marking the country's most formidable appearance at the competition to date.
India's Chess Grandmasters Eye Glory at EWC 2026 in Paris
Four Indian Grandmasters are set to compete in the chess tournament at the Esports World Cup 2026, held in Paris, France, from August 11 to 15, according to a press release cited by ANI news agency. The event marks Indian chess's strongest-ever representation at the Esports World Cup, according to the report published on August 8, 2026. Among the Indian Grandmasters preparing to compete is Arjun Erigaisi, whose photograph was published by ANI with an image credited to the Esports World Cup.
